Transaction 0259cb5cfaa839eaf95a66e03a73bc0e4b0401bf11cb7a803611f03eaba9b192

1 Input
2 Outputs
  • 0259cb5cfaa839eaf95a66e03a73bc0e4b0401bf11cb7a803611f03eaba9b192:0
  • value  22860079
    address  3C5pcbmV1rtq8qS1Wuc3JGoKgKG3EuYfGF
  • 0259cb5cfaa839eaf95a66e03a73bc0e4b0401bf11cb7a803611f03eaba9b192:1
  • value  9659423
    address  168x4jw6Y3EMKyCVje1RgByyGKCubkbnuG